There are three different types of mental health treatment, including residential, outpatient, and hospital inpatient. Some individuals who need assistance for a mental health problem might desire an outpatient approach due to their responsibilities or because of the stigma they'd like to avoid because of their disorder. Most clients can still have a normal school or work day and get outpatient mental health care with 100% discretion and privacy.
Outpatient mental health centers are usually based in private offices, hospitals or community health centers in Horace. The intensity of outpatient mental health care can vary from center to center, but can be from participation a few days a week to daily treatment. An outpatient mental health facility will first do a complete evaluation of the individual's medical history, both physical and mental, including their illicit drug and prescription drug history. Psychological testing is also an usual procedure, and clinicians and medical staff will come up with a course of treatment that may include group therapy, marriage or couples counseling, family therapy, individual psychotherapy, etc. If the client requiring treatment also has a co-occurring disorder such as an alcohol or drug addiction, most outpatient mental health centers are ready to treat such a dual diagnosis.
